缠论自动化实战:5分钟掌握ChanlunX插件,告别手工画图的烦恼

张开发
2026/5/7 16:09:53 15 分钟阅读

分享文章

缠论自动化实战:5分钟掌握ChanlunX插件,告别手工画图的烦恼
缠论自动化实战5分钟掌握ChanlunX插件告别手工画图的烦恼【免费下载链接】ChanlunX缠中说禅炒股缠论可视化插件项目地址: https://gitcode.com/gh_mirrors/ch/ChanlunX你是否曾为缠论分析中繁琐的笔、段、中枢手工绘制而烦恼ChanlunX缠论插件正是为解决这一痛点而生。这款专为通达信设计的开源插件通过C算法自动识别缠论结构将复杂的缠论理论转化为直观的可视化图表让你在5分钟内就能完成原本需要数小时的手工分析工作。为什么你需要ChanlunX传统缠论分析的三大痛点缠论作为中国证券市场最具影响力的技术分析理论其核心价值在于通过笔、段、中枢等概念对价格走势进行结构化分析。然而传统的手工分析方法存在以下三大痛点效率低下手工绘制笔、段、中枢耗时耗力难以实时跟踪市场变化主观性强不同分析师对同一走势可能有不同的划分结果缺乏标准化学习曲线陡峭初学者难以掌握复杂的划分规则容易出错ChanlunX缠论插件通过自动化算法解决了这些问题。它基于缠论原著的核心规则实现了笔、段、中枢的自动识别和绘制让你能够专注于交易策略而非技术细节。快速入门5分钟完成ChanlunX部署环境准备与编译ChanlunX采用现代C开发使用CMake构建系统。你需要以下环境CMake 3.20或更高版本Visual Studio 2019支持C17通达信金融终端编译步骤极其简单# 克隆项目源码 git clone https://gitcode.com/gh_mirrors/ch/ChanlunX cd ChanlunX # 创建构建目录并编译 mkdir build cd build # 32位通达信使用Win3264位使用x64 cmake -A Win32 .. cmake --build . --config Release编译完成后你会得到ChanlunX.dll文件这就是缠论分析的核心插件。插件安装与配置安装过程只需两步将ChanlunX.dll复制到通达信的T0002\dlls\目录在通达信中创建主图公式绑定插件函数ChanlunX插件在上证指数日线图上的应用效果清晰展示了笔、线段和中枢结构核心功能深度解析ChanlunX如何实现缠论自动化笔识别算法从K线到笔的精确转换笔是缠论分析的最小单位ChanlunX通过Bi.cpp和Bi.h中的算法实现了精确的笔端点识别。核心算法流程如下K线包含处理首先对相邻K线进行包含处理确保每根K线都是独立的顶底分型识别识别符合缠论定义的顶分型和底分型笔的确认在顶底分型之间至少包含一根独立K线笔的延伸处理笔的延伸和新笔的产生条件// Bi.h中的核心函数声明 std::vectorfloat Bi1(int nCount, std::vectorfloat pHigh, std::vectorfloat pLow); std::vectorfloat Bi2(int nCount, std::vectorfloat pHigh, std::vectorfloat pLow);这两个函数分别对应简笔和标准笔的识别算法为后续的段和中枢分析奠定基础。段构建逻辑从笔到段的智能升级段由至少三笔构成ChanlunX在Duan.cpp中实现了段的自动构建算法。插件支持两种终结画法标准终结画法严格遵循缠论原文定义11终结画法更符合实际交易应用的简化版本段的构建关键在于正确处理笔的破坏和段的延续。算法通过分析笔的端点关系自动判断段的开始和结束避免了手工划分的主观性。中枢识别缠论分析的核心引擎中枢是缠论分析的核心ChanlunX通过ZhongShu.cpp实现了多级别中枢的自动识别笔中枢识别在至少三笔重叠的区域识别笔中枢段中枢识别在至少三段重叠的区域识别段中枢中枢级别划分通过递归算法识别不同时间级别的中枢中枢方向判断识别中枢的上涨、下跌或盘整状态ChanlunX插件简化分析界面突出核心中枢结构和趋势延续性实战应用ChanlunX在交易决策中的四大场景场景一日线级别趋势分析对于中长期投资者日线级别的缠论分析具有重要指导意义。ChanlunX在日线图上可以清晰展示大级别中枢识别月线或周线级别的中枢结构趋势段划分明确当前处于上涨段、下跌段还是盘整段买卖点识别通过中枢的第三类买卖点辅助决策场景二分钟线精确买卖点捕捉短线交易者可以利用分钟线进行精确的买卖点捕捉5分钟笔段分析在小级别上识别笔和段的转折点中枢震荡操作在中枢震荡区间进行高抛低吸趋势突破确认通过小级别走势确认大级别突破的有效性场景三选股策略定制基于ChanlunX的缠论分析可以构建多种选股策略三浪下跌模式识别完成三浪下跌结构的个股五浪下跌模式寻找完成完整五浪下跌的标的中枢突破策略筛选即将突破重要中枢的股票场景四五彩K线增强分析ChanlunX支持五彩K线功能通过颜色区分不同的市场状态上涨K线显示为醒目的红色代表多头强势下跌K线显示为清晰的青色代表空头主导特殊标记涨停板和跌停板有特殊标识常见陷阱与规避方法陷阱一参数设置不当导致识别错误问题表现笔段识别不准确中枢范围过大或过小解决方案调整笔的最小波动幅度过滤微小波动根据市场波动性调整段的最小笔数优化中枢的最小重叠区域参数陷阱二多周期数据不一致问题表现不同时间周期的分析结果矛盾解决方案确保数据源的时序一致性建立分钟线、日线、周线之间的级别对应关系采用递归分析方法从最小级别开始逐级向上陷阱三过度依赖自动化分析问题表现完全信任插件结果忽视人工验证解决方案将自动化分析作为辅助工具而非决策依据定期抽查关键位置的笔段划分结合其他技术指标进行综合判断性能调优秘籍让ChanlunX运行更高效编译优化技巧ChanlunX采用静态链接方式确保插件运行时不依赖外部库。编译时可以启用以下优化选项# 启用高级优化 target_compile_options(ChanlunX PRIVATE /O2 /MT /utf-8) # 针对不同CPU架构优化 if(MSVC) target_compile_options(ChanlunX PRIVATE /arch:AVX2) endif()内存使用优化数据预分配在插件初始化时预分配足够的内存空间算法优化采用迭代算法而非递归避免栈溢出缓存机制对频繁计算的结果进行缓存提高响应速度多周期数据处理策略ChanlunX支持同时处理多个时间周期的数据优化策略包括数据同步确保不同周期数据的时序一致性级别对应建立分钟线、日线、周线之间的级别对应关系递归分析从最小级别开始逐级向上递归分析进阶应用场景ChanlunX的高级用法自定义指标开发基于ChanlunX的框架你可以扩展自定义指标算法模块复用直接调用Bi、Duan、ZhongShu等核心算法接口标准化遵循通达信插件开发规范测试框架支持利用GoogleTest进行单元测试批量分析自动化通过脚本调用ChanlunX插件实现批量股票分析# 示例批量分析股票列表 import subprocess import pandas as pd def batch_analyze(stock_list, time_period): results [] for stock in stock_list: # 调用ChanlunX分析函数 result analyze_stock(stock, time_period) results.append(result) return pd.DataFrame(results)与其他分析工具集成ChanlunX可以与其他技术分析工具结合使用与MACD结合验证缠论买卖点与MACD背离的共振与成交量结合分析中枢突破时的量价关系与均线系统结合确认趋势的强度和持续性从快速入门到精通学习路线图5分钟上手路线安装部署按照快速入门指南完成插件安装基础使用在主图上应用缠论公式观察笔段划分简单分析识别当前走势的中枢结构和趋势方向30分钟精通路线参数调优根据市场特性调整识别参数多周期分析在不同时间周期上应用缠论分析策略验证回测历史数据验证分析准确性风险控制设置止损止盈点管理交易风险深度精通路线源码研究深入理解Bi.cpp、Duan.cpp、ZhongShu.cpp等核心算法算法优化根据个人交易经验优化识别算法功能扩展开发自定义指标和扩展功能社区贡献参与开源项目分享改进方案对比分析ChanlunX vs 传统手工分析效率对比分析项目传统手工分析ChanlunX自动化笔识别时间5-10分钟/图表实时自动识别段构建时间10-15分钟/图表实时自动构建中枢识别时间15-20分钟/图表实时自动识别多周期分析难以同步进行一键同步分析准确性对比准确性指标传统手工分析ChanlunX自动化划分一致性主观性强易变算法统一结果稳定规则遵循度依赖分析师水平严格遵循缠论规则错误率初学者较高算法验证错误率低可重复性难以完全重复完全可重复技术架构解析ChanlunX的设计哲学模块化设计ChanlunX采用高度模块化的设计各功能模块独立且可复用Bi模块负责笔的识别和处理Duan模块负责段的构建和分析ZhongShu模块负责中枢的识别和标注KxianChuLi模块负责K线包含处理接口标准化插件通过标准化的DLL接口与通达信通信// 通达信插件函数接口 typedef void (*pPluginFUNC)(int nCount, float *pOut, float *a, float *b, float *c);性能优化策略内存管理使用智能指针和内存池技术算法优化采用高效的数据结构和算法并行计算支持多线程处理提高分析速度最佳实践ChanlunX使用指南实践一趋势跟踪策略识别大级别中枢在日线或周线图上识别主要中枢分析趋势段确定当前处于哪个趋势段寻找买卖点在中枢边缘或突破位置寻找交易机会设置止损在中枢内部设置止损点实践二震荡交易策略识别震荡中枢在分钟线或小时线上识别震荡中枢确定震荡区间明确中枢的上轨和下轨高抛低吸在区间上下轨进行反向操作突破跟进当价格突破区间时及时跟进实践三多周期共振策略小级别确认在分钟线上确认买卖点大级别验证在日线或周线上验证趋势方向周期共振寻找多周期共振的交易机会风险控制设置多级别止损点持续学习与社区支持学习资源推荐缠论原著《缠中说禅》系列文章通达信开发文档通达信插件开发指南C编程指南现代C编程实践技术分析经典《日本蜡烛图技术》等社区参与指南ChanlunX作为开源项目欢迎社区参与问题反馈在使用过程中遇到问题可以通过GitHub Issues反馈功能建议提出新功能建议或改进方案代码贡献提交Pull Request改进算法或修复bug经验分享分享使用经验和交易策略后续学习路径基础巩固熟练掌握缠论基本概念和规则技术深化学习高级缠论分析技巧实战应用在实际交易中应用ChanlunX分析系统构建构建完整的缠论交易系统结语开启缠论分析的新时代ChanlunX缠论插件不仅仅是一个技术工具更是缠论分析方法的革命性升级。它将复杂的理论转化为实用的分析工具让每一位投资者都能享受到缠论分析的便利和准确性。无论你是缠论初学者还是资深分析师ChanlunX都能为你提供价值。对于初学者它降低了学习门槛对于资深用户它提高了分析效率。更重要的是ChanlunX的开源特性意味着你可以根据自己的需求进行定制和优化。记住技术分析只是投资决策的辅助工具。真正的成功还需要结合基本面分析、风险管理和投资纪律。建议从模拟交易开始逐步积累经验最终形成适合自己的交易系统。最后提醒投资有风险入市需谨慎。ChanlunX提供的是技术分析工具不构成投资建议。请理性投资控制风险。【免费下载链接】ChanlunX缠中说禅炒股缠论可视化插件项目地址: https://gitcode.com/gh_mirrors/ch/ChanlunX创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

更多文章